New Construction Wiring in Alpharetta, GA
New construction wiring services involve installing electrical systems in newly built properties or major renovations. This includes planning and setting up the electrical infrastructure needed to power lighting, outlets, appliances, and other electrical devices. Projects can range from single-family homes and multi-unit residential buildings to commercial spaces and large-scale developments. Property owners typically want to understand the scope of wiring required, the materials used, and how the system will meet current electrical codes and future needs.
Before requesting new construction wiring, property owners should consider factors such as the size and layout of the property, the number of circuits needed, and any specific electrical requirements for appliances or systems. It’s also important to discuss plans for future expansion or upgrades, as well as any preferences for energy efficiency or smart home integrations. Clear communication about these aspects helps ensure the electrical system is designed to support the property’s functionality and safety from the start.

New Construction Wiring Questions
What types of new construction wiring services are available? Services include wiring for residential homes, new commercial buildings, and multi-unit developments to ensure proper electrical system setup from the ground up.
Why is proper wiring important in new construction? Correct wiring ensures safety, supports all electrical devices, and complies with building codes for long-term reliability.
When should wiring be installed during construction? Wiring is typically installed during the framing or rough-in phase before walls are finished to allow proper placement and access.
What should property owners consider when planning new wiring? It's important to plan for current and future electrical needs, including outlets, lighting, and special circuits for appliances or equipment.
